Understanding Tolerances and Specifications in Precision Aluminum Extrusion

Understanding tolerances and specifications in precision aluminum extrusion is crucial for designing and manufacturing high-quality extruded components. This article provides an in-depth exploration of the different types of tolerances, their impact, and the importance of adhering to industry standards.

Dimensional Tolerances

Dimensional tolerances refer to the allowable variations in the size and shape of the extruded profile. These tolerances are typically expressed in fractions of an inch or millimeters and include deviations in length, width, height, and angles. Maintaining tight dimensional tolerances ensures that the extruded components fit precisely into their intended applications.

Mechanical Tolerances

Mechanical tolerances specify the strength, hardness, and other mechanical properties of the extruded aluminum. These tolerances are critical for ensuring the performance and durability of the components. Tensile strength, yield strength, and elongation are common mechanical properties subject to tolerances. By controlling these properties, manufacturers can tailor the aluminum extrusion to meet the specific requirements of the application.

Surface Tolerances

Surface tolerances define the allowable imperfections on the surface of the extruded profile. Factors such as roughness, smoothness, and coating thickness fall under surface tolerances. Roughness is measured in terms of microinches or microns and indicates the presence of microscopic peaks and valleys on the surface. Smooth surfaces are essential for applications requiring a pristine finish or tight tolerances between mating parts.

Adherence to Standards

Industry standards, such as those established by the Aluminum Extruders Council (AEC) or the American Society for Testing and Materials (ASTM), provide guidelines for tolerances and specifications in precision aluminum extrusion. These standards ensure uniformity and consistency among manufacturers and help to eliminate confusion or misinterpretation. Adherence to standards facilitates communication between customers and suppliers, streamlines the production process, and enhances product quality.

Communication and Collaboration

Effective communication between customers and extrusion manufacturers is critical for accurate and efficient production. Clear specifications and unambiguous drawings help minimize errors and ensure that the extruded components meet design expectations. Collaboration during the design and manufacturing phases enables adjustments or modifications to tolerances and specifications, leading to optimized products and reduced lead times.

Quality Control and Verification

Rigorous quality control measures are essential for verifying the adherence to tolerances and specifications. Inspection and testing procedures, such as dimensional gauging, tensile testing, and surface roughness analysis, provide assurance that the extruded components meet the required standards. Continuous monitoring and feedback mechanisms allow for adjustments to the extrusion process, ensuring consistent quality and minimizing potential defects.
